Cerro Incahuasi
Cerro Incahuasi is a mountain in Cahuacho District, Caravelí Province, Arequipa and has an elevation of 3,947 metres. Cerro Incahuasi is situated nearby to the hamlet Abas Chacra, as well as near the village Airoca.| Tap on a place to explore it |
